Abstract :
A new isosurface reconstruction scheme from a set of tomographic cross-sectional images is presented. The method, called shrink-wrapped isosurface (SWIS), surmounts the O(l)-adjacency limitation of the marching cubes algorithm by generalising the concept of isopoints (iso-density points). The coarse initial mesh is iteratively metamorphosed into the final isosurfaces by the shrink-wrapping process. Experiments prove SWIS to be very robust and efficient in isosurface reconstruction.
